Tom Vauthier, Partner at Bredin Prat, is a member of the firm’s Litigation team.

He advises and represents companies and their senior executives in proceedings before the civil, commercial and criminal courts.

His practice focuses on corporate litigation (shareholder conflicts, M&A transactions, directors’ liability, etc.), commercial litigation, unfair competition as well as disputes relating to the ‘duty of vigilance’ and CSR issues.

In this respect, he regularly assists his clients in class actions, whether regarding consumer law, unfair competition or in the context of follow-on actions.

Tom was seconded to Kirkland & Ellis in New York from 2017 to 2018.
